Job Shadow in Higher Education / Development / Alumni Relations (Miami, FL)

The University of Miami Development & Alumni Relations mission is to establish and enhance a mutually beneficial and enduring relationship between the University of Miami, its alumni and current and future students. We shall work to promote the excellence of the University of Miami by serving as ambassadors and encouraging involvement and volunteerism; fostering love, respect, and pride in the University; and obtaining support, communicating the message and furthering the overall mission of our alma mater.

The host for this opportunity is Sarah Seavey, the Director of Professional Development & Training and also a UA Alum!

In this opportunity, students will be able to witness the daily process of creating an internal career ladder system that includes incentives, badging, professional development, skill-based training, train-the-trainer model, training and development, facilitation and more. The opportunity also exists to be exposed to event planning, alumni and constituent engagement, fundraising, marketing, web development, and many more areas within the division on a tour and meet and greets with other staff members.
